3. Can you explain/differentiate between views and layouts? I understand that views is drag and drop builder though
Views is a plugin to render data.
This means you define what data to get, and how to display it.
Layouts is a tool that lets you define the loop and location of elements on your Website.
It's a Drag And Drop Bootstrap Layout Builder.
You can insert Cells (also Views) and move them with DnD, and this will then apply to your front end.
More about Layouts here: https://toolset.com/documentation/user-guides/#layouts
It needs to be integrated with your Theme, unless you use Toolset Starter Theme or an integrated Theme like DIVI + The Toolset DIVI integration.

When creating a new post type, can I leave the 'labels' default or do I need to edit the '%s'
Can I edit the custom post type anytime to include or delete a new 'text or similar' section?
If I am to delete/disable such a section, what happens to the content in the posts already published?
Beda is on vacation. Let me answer that last question for you.
When you make a new post type it is unlikely you will need to change the default labels unless you have a very specific reason to. As you can see in the screenshot, where I am on the post edit screen to create a new post of the post type Project, the labels are used in the admin pages to show "Add New Project", for example, instead of a generic "Add New Post".
- "Can I edit the custom post type anytime to include or delete a new 'text or similar' section?"
I'm not sure what you mean by "text or similar" section.
A post, whether it is a standard WordPress post or a custom post type defined by Types or another plugin, has certain standard fields, such as the post title, the post body (the content), the post excerpt, the post author etc.
You can add additional fields, including single line or multi-line text fields, using Types custom fields which you assign to that post type. So you might add a custom field "Description" to your custom post type. When you create your custom posts you will be able to fill in this field and it will be saved alongside the post.
If you then removed the custom field from Types (or disabled Types) the custom field content for the posts would still exist in the database, but when editing the posts you would no longer see it (you would have to query the database to retrieve it).
